The use of google trends in health care research: a systematic review.

Sudhakar V. Nuti; Brian Wayda; Isuru Ranasinghe; Sisi Wang; Rachel P. Dreyer; Serene I. Chen; Karthik Murugiah

Background Google Trends is a novel, freely accessible tool that allows users to interact with Internet search data, which may provide deep insights into population behavior and health-related phenomena. However, there is limited knowledge about its potential uses and limitations. We therefore systematically reviewed health care literature using Google Trends to classify articles by topic and study aim; evaluate the methodology and validation of the tool; and address limitations for its use in research. Methods and Findings PRISMA guidelines were followed. Two independent reviewers systematically identified studies utilizing Google Trends for health care research from MEDLINE and PubMed. Seventy studies met our inclusion criteria. Google Trends publications increased seven-fold from 2009 to 2013. Studies were classified into four topic domains: infectious disease (27% of articles), mental health and substance use (24%), other non-communicable diseases (16%), and general population behavior (33%). By use, 27% of articles utilized Google Trends for casual inference, 39% for description, and 34% for surveillance. Among surveillance studies, 92% were validated against a reference standard data source, and 80% of studies using correlation had a correlation statistic ≥0.70. Overall, 67% of articles provided a rationale for their search input. However, only 7% of articles were reproducible based on complete documentation of search strategy. We present a checklist to facilitate appropriate methodological documentation for future studies. A limitation of the study is the challenge of classifying heterogeneous studies utilizing a novel data source. Conclusion Google Trends is being used to study health phenomena in a variety of topic domains in myriad ways. However, poor documentation of methods precludes the reproducibility of the findings. Such documentation would enable other researchers to determine the consistency of results provided by Google Trends for a well-specified query over time. Furthermore, greater transparency can improve its reliability as a research tool.

Systematic Review of Patients Presenting With Suspected Myocardial Infarction and Nonobstructive Coronary Arteries

Sivabaskari Pasupathy; Tracy Air; Rachel P. Dreyer; Rosanna Tavella; John F. Beltrame

Background— Myocardial infarction with nonobstructive coronary arteries (MINOCA) is a puzzling clinical entity with no previous evaluation of the literature. This systematic review aims to (1) quantify the prevalence, risk factors, and 12-month prognosis in patients with MINOCA, and (2) evaluate potential pathophysiological mechanisms underlying this disorder. Methods and Results— Quantitative assessment of 28 publications using a meta-analytic approach evaluated the prevalence, clinical features, and prognosis of MINOCA. The prevalence of MINOCA was 6% [95% confidence interval, 5%–7%] with a median patient age of 55 years (95% confidence interval, 51–59 years) and 40% women. However, in comparison with those with myocardial infarction associated with obstructive coronary artery disease, the patients with MINOCA were more likely to be younger and female but less likely to have hyperlipidemia, although other cardiovascular risk factors were similar. All-cause mortality at 12 months was lower in MINOCA (4.7%; 95% confidence interval, 2.6%–6.9%) compared with myocardial infarction associated with obstructive coronary artery disease (6.7%, 95% confidence interval, 4.3%–9.0%). Qualitative assessment of 46 publications evaluating the underlying pathophysiology responsible for MINOCA revealed the presence of a typical myocardial infarct on cardiac magnetic resonance imaging in only 24% of patients, with myocarditis occurring in 33% and no significant abnormality in 26%. Coronary artery spasm was inducible in 27% of MINOCA patients, and thrombophilia disorders were detected in 14%. Conclusions— MINOCA should be considered as a working diagnosis with multiple potential causes that require evaluation so that directed therapies may improve its guarded prognosis.

Sex Differences in Long-Term Mortality after Myocardial Infarction: A Systematic Review

Emily M. Bucholz; Neel M. Butala; Saif S. Rathore; Rachel P. Dreyer; Alexandra J. Lansky; Harlan M. Krumholz

Background— Studies of sex differences in long-term mortality after acute myocardial infarction have reported mixed results. A systematic review is needed to characterize what is known about sex differences in long-term outcomes and to define gaps in knowledge. Methods and Results— We searched the Medline database from 1966 to December 2012 to identify all studies that provided sex-based comparisons of mortality after acute myocardial infarction. Only studies with at least 5 years of follow-up were reviewed. Of the 1877 identified abstracts, 52 studies met the inclusion criteria, of which 39 were included in this review. Most studies included fewer than one-third women. There was significant heterogeneity across studies in patient populations, methodology, and risk adjustment, which produced substantial variability in risk estimates. In general, most studies reported higher unadjusted mortality for women compared with men at both 5 and 10 years after acute myocardial infarction; however, many of the differences in mortality became attenuated after adjustment for age. Multivariable models varied between studies; however, most reported a further reduction in sex differences after adjustment for covariates other than age. Few studies examined sex-by-age interactions; however, several studies reported interactions between sex and treatment whereby women have similar mortality risk as men after revascularization. Conclusions— Sex differences in long-term mortality after acute myocardial infarction are largely explained by differences in age, comorbidities, and treatment use between women and men. Future research should aim to clarify how these differences in risk factors and presentation contribute to the sex gap in mortality.

Sex Differences in Reperfusion in Young Patients With ST-Segment–Elevation Myocardial Infarction Results From the VIRGO Study

Gail D’Onofrio; Basmah Safdar; Judith H. Lichtman; Kelly M. Strait; Rachel P. Dreyer; Mary Geda; John A. Spertus; Harlan M. Krumholz

Background— Sex disparities in reperfusion therapy for patients with acute ST-segment–elevation myocardial infarction have been documented. However, little is known about whether these patterns exist in the comparison of young women with men. Methods and Results— We examined sex differences in rates, types of reperfusion therapy, and proportion of patients exceeding American Heart Association reperfusion time guidelines for ST-segment–elevation myocardial infarction in a prospective observational cohort study (2008–2012) of 1465 patients 18 to 55 years of age, as part of the US Variations in Recovery: Role of Gender on Outcomes of Young AMI Patients (VIRGO) study at 103 hospitals enrolling in a 2:1 ratio of women to men. Of the 1238 patients eligible for reperfusion, women were more likely to be untreated than men (9% versus 4%, P=0.002). There was no difference in reperfusion strategy for the 695 women and 458 men treated. Women were more likely to exceed in-hospital and transfer time guidelines for percutaneous coronary intervention than men (41% versus 29%; odds ratio, 1.65; 95% confidence interval, 1.27–2.16), more so when transferred (67% versus 44%; odds ratio, 2.63; 95% confidence interval, 1.17–4.07); and more likely to exceed door-to-needle times (67% versus 37%; odds ratio, 2.62; 95% confidence interval, 1.23–2.18). After adjustment for sociodemographic, clinical, and organizational factors, sex remained an important factor in exceeding reperfusion guidelines (odds ratio, 1.72; 95% confidence interval, 1.28–2.33). Conclusions— Young women with ST-segment–elevation myocardial infarction are less likely to receive reperfusion therapy and more likely to have reperfusion delays than similarly aged men. Sex disparities are more pronounced among patients transferred to percutaneous coronary intervention institutions or who received fibrinolytic therapy.

Gender Differences in the Trajectory of Recovery in Health Status Among Young Patients With Acute Myocardial Infarction Results From the Variation in Recovery: Role of Gender on Outcomes of Young AMI Patients (VIRGO) Study

Rachel P. Dreyer; Yongfei Wang; Kelly M. Strait; Nancy P. Lorenze; Gail D’Onofrio; Héctor Bueno; Judith H. Lichtman; John A. Spertus; Harlan M. Krumholz

Background— Despite the excess risk of mortality in young women (⩽55 years of age) after acute myocardial infarction (AMI), little is known about young women’s health status (symptoms, functioning, quality of life) during the first year of recovery after an AMI. We examined gender differences in health status over time from baseline to 12 months after AMI. Methods and Results— A total of 3501 AMI patients (67% women) 18 to 55 years of age were enrolled from 103 US and 24 Spanish hospitals. Data were obtained by medical record abstraction and patient interviews at baseline hospitalization and 1 and 12 months after AMI. Health status was measured by generic (Short Form-12) and disease-specific (Seattle Angina Questionnaire) measures. We compared health status scores at all 3 time points and used longitudinal linear mixed-effects analyses to examine the independent effect of gender, adjusting for time and selected covariates. Women had significantly lower health status scores than men at each assessment (all P values <0.0001). After adjustment for time and all covariates, women had Short Form-12 physical/mental summary scores that were −0.96 (95% confidence interval [CI], −1.59 to −0.32) and −2.36 points (95% CI, −2.99 to −1.73) lower than those of men, as well as worse Seattle Angina Questionnaire physical limitations (−2.44 points lower; 95% CI, −3.53 to −1.34), more angina (−1.03 points lower; 95% CI, −1.98 to −0.07), and poorer quality of life (−3.51 points lower; 95% CI, −4.80 to −2.22). Conclusion— Although both genders recover similarly after AMI, women have poorer scores than men on all health status measures, a difference that persisted throughout the entire year after discharge.

Sex Differences in the Rate, Timing, and Principal Diagnoses of 30-Day Readmissions in Younger Patients with Acute Myocardial Infarction

Rachel P. Dreyer; Isuru Ranasinghe; Yongfei Wang; Kumar Dharmarajan; Karthik Murugiah; Sudhakar V. Nuti; Angela F. Hsieh; John A. Spertus; Harlan M. Krumholz

Background— Young women (<65 years) experience a 2- to 3-fold greater mortality risk than younger men after an acute myocardial infarction. However, it is unknown whether they are at higher risk for 30-day readmission, and if this association varies by age. We examined sex differences in the rate, timing, and principal diagnoses of 30-day readmissions, including the independent effect of sex following adjustment for confounders. Methods and Results— We included patients aged 18 to 64 years with a principal diagnosis of acute myocardial infarction. Data were used from the Healthcare Cost and Utilization Project-State Inpatient Database for California (07–09). Readmission diagnoses were categorized by using an aggregated version of the Centers for Medicare and Medicaid Services’ Condition Categories, and readmission timing was determined from the day after discharge. Of 42 518 younger patients with acute myocardial infarction (26.4% female), 4775 (11.2%) had at least 1 readmission. The 30-day all-cause readmission rate was higher for women (15.5% versus 9.7%, P<0.0001). For both sexes, readmission risk was highest on days 2 to 4 after discharge and declined thereafter, and women were more likely to present with noncardiac diagnoses (44.4% versus 40.6%, P=0.01). Female sex was associated with a higher rate of 30-day readmission, which persisted after adjustment (hazard ratio, 1.22; 95% confidence interval, 1.15–1.30). There was no significant interaction between age and sex on readmission. Conclusions— In comparison with men, younger women have a higher risk for readmission, even after the adjustment for confounders. The timing of 30-day readmission was similar in women and men, and both sexes were susceptible to a wide range of causes for readmission.

Effect of Low Perceived Social Support on Health Outcomes in Young Patients With Acute Myocardial Infarction: Results From the Variation in Recovery: Role of Gender on Outcomes of Young AMI Patients (VIRGO) Study

Emily M. Bucholz; Kelly M. Strait; Rachel P. Dreyer; Mary Geda; Erica S. Spatz; Héctor Bueno; Judith H. Lichtman; Gail D'Onofrio; John A. Spertus; Harlan M. Krumholz

Background Social support is an important predictor of health outcomes after acute myocardial infarction (AMI), but social support varies by sex and age. Differences in social support could account for sex differences in outcomes of young patients with AMI. Methods and Results Data from the Variation in Recovery: Role of Gender on Outcomes of Young AMI Patients (VIRGO) study, an observational study of AMI patients aged ≤55 years in the United States and Spain, were used for this study. Patients were categorized as having low versus moderate/high perceived social support using the ENRICHD Social Support Inventory. Outcomes included health status (Short Form‐12 physical and mental component scores), depressive symptoms (Patient Health Questionnaire), and angina‐related quality of life (Seattle Angina Questionnaire) evaluated at baseline and 12 months. Among 3432 patients, 21.2% were classified as having low social support. Men and women had comparable levels of social support at baseline. On average, patients with low social support reported lower functional status and quality of life and more depressive symptoms at baseline and 12 months post‐AMI. After multivariable adjustment, including baseline health status, low social support was associated with lower mental functioning, lower quality of life, and more depressive symptoms at 12 months (all P<0.001). The relationship between low social support and worse physical functioning was nonsignificant after adjustment (P=0.6). No interactions were observed between social support, sex, or country. Conclusion Lower social support is associated with worse health status and more depressive symptoms 12 months after AMI in both young men and women. Sex did not modify the effect of social support.

Trends in Short- and Long-Term Outcomes for Takotsubo Cardiomyopathy Among Medicare Fee-for-Service Beneficiaries, 2007 to 2012

Karthik Murugiah; Yun Wang; Nihar R. Desai; Erica S. Spatz; Sudhakar V. Nuti; Rachel P. Dreyer; Harlan M. Krumholz

OBJECTIVES The aim of this study was to assess trends in hospitalizations and outcomes for Takotsubo cardiomyopathy (TTC). BACKGROUND There is a paucity of nationally representative data on trends in short- and long-term outcomes for patients with TTC. METHODS The authors examined hospitalization rates; in-hospital, 30-day, and 1-year mortality; and all-cause 30-day readmission for Medicare fee-for-service beneficiaries with principal and secondary diagnoses of TTC from 2007 to 2012. RESULTS Hospitalizations for principal or secondary diagnosis of TTC increased from 5.7 per 100,000 person-years in 2007 to 17.4 in 2012 (p for trend < 0.001). Patients were predominantly women and of white race. For principal TTC, in-hospital, 30-day, and 1-year mortality was 1.3% (95% confidence interval [CI]: 1.1% to 1.6%), 2.5% (95% CI: 2.2% to 2.8%), and 6.9% (95% CI: 6.4% to 7.5%), and the 30-day readmission rate was 11.6% (95% CI: 10.9% to 12.3%). For secondary TTC, in-hospital, 30-day, and 1-year mortality was 3% (95% CI: 2.7% to 3.3%), 4.7% (95% CI: 4.4% to 5.1%), and 11.4% (95% CI: 10.8% to 11.9%), and the 30-day readmission rate was 15.8% (95% CI: 15.1% to 16.4%). Over time, there was no change in mortality or readmission rate for both cohorts. Patients ≥85 years of age had higher in-hospital, 30-day, and 1-year mortality and 30-day readmission rates. Among patients with principal TTC, male and nonwhite patients had higher 1-year mortality than their counterparts, whereas in those with secondary TTC, mortality was worse at all 3 time points. Nonwhite patients had higher 30-day readmission rates for both cohorts. CONCLUSIONS Hospitalization rates for TTC are increasing, but short- and long-term outcomes have not changed. At 1 year, 14 in 15 patients with principal TTC and 8 in 9 with secondary TTC are alive. Older, male, and nonwhite patients have worse outcomes.

Depressive Symptoms in Younger Women and Men With Acute Myocardial Infarction: Insights From the VIRGO Study

Kim G. Smolderen; Kelly M. Strait; Rachel P. Dreyer; Gail D'Onofrio; Shengfan Zhou; Judith H. Lichtman; Mary Geda; Héctor Bueno; John F. Beltrame; Basmah Safdar; Harlan M. Krumholz; John A. Spertus

Background Depression was recently recognized as a risk factor for adverse medical outcomes in patients with acute myocardial infarction (AMI). The degree to which depression is present among younger patients with an AMI, the patient profile associated with being a young AMI patient with depressive symptoms, and whether relevant sex differences exist are currently unknown. Methods and Results The Variation in Recovery: Role of Gender on Outcomes of Young AMI Patients (VIRGO) study enrolled 3572 patients with AMI (67.1% women; 2:1 ratio for women to men) between 2008 and 2012 (at 103 hospitals in the United States, 24 in Spain, and 3 in Australia). Information about lifetime history of depression and depressive symptoms experienced over the past 2 weeks (Patient Health Questionnaire; a cutoff score ≥10 was used for depression screening) was collected during index AMI admission. Information on demographics, socioeconomic status, cardiovascular risk, AMI severity, perceived stress (14‐item Perceived Stress Scale), and health status (Seattle Angina Questionnaire, EuroQoL 5D) was obtained through interviews and chart abstraction. Nearly half (48%) of the women reported a lifetime history of depression versus 1 in 4 in men (24%; P<0.0001). At the time of admission for AMI, more women than men experienced depressive symptoms (39% versus 22%, P<0.0001; adjusted odds ratio 1.64; 95% CI 1.36 to 1.98). Patients with more depressive symptoms had higher levels of stress and worse quality of life (P<0.001). Depressive symptoms were more prevalent among patients with lower socioeconomic profiles (eg, lower education, uninsured) and with more cardiovascular risk factors (eg, diabetes, smoking). Conclusions A high rate of lifetime history of depression and depressive symptoms at the time of an AMI was observed among younger women compared with men. Depressive symptoms affected those with more vulnerable socioeconomic and clinical profiles.

Sex differences in young patients with acute myocardial infarction: A VIRGO study analysis.

Emily M. Bucholz; Kelly M. Strait; Rachel P. Dreyer; Stacy Tessler Lindau; Gail D’Onofrio; Mary Geda; Erica S. Spatz; John F. Beltrame; Judith H. Lichtman; Nancy P. Lorenze; Héctor Bueno; Harlan M. Krumholz

Aims: Young women with acute myocardial infarction (AMI) have a higher risk of adverse outcomes than men. However, it is unclear how young women with AMI are different from young men across a spectrum of characteristics. We sought to compare young women and men at the time of AMI on six domains of demographic and clinical factors in order to determine whether they have distinct profiles. Methods and results: Using data from Variation in Recovery: Role of Gender on Outcomes of Young AMI Patients (VIRGO), a prospective cohort study of women and men aged ⩽55 years hospitalized for AMI (n = 3501) in the United States and Spain, we evaluated sex differences in demographics, healthcare access, cardiovascular risk and psychosocial factors, symptoms and pre-hospital delay, clinical presentation, and hospital management for AMI. The study sample included 2349 (67%) women and 1152 (33%) men with a mean age of 47 years. Young women with AMI had higher rates of cardiovascular risk factors and comorbidities than men, including diabetes, congestive heart failure, chronic obstructive pulmonary disease, renal failure, and morbid obesity. They also exhibited higher levels of depression and stress, poorer physical and mental health status, and lower quality of life at baseline. Women had more delays in presentation and presented with higher clinical risk scores on average than men; however, men presented with higher levels of cardiac biomarkers and more classic electrocardiogram findings. Women were less likely to undergo revascularization procedures during hospitalization, and women with ST segment elevation myocardial infarction were less likely to receive timely primary reperfusion. Conclusions: Young women with AMI represent a distinct, higher-risk population that is different from young men.
